> > Mozilla is still kind of a native X app while MOL will probably shove pixmaps
> > over the wire like hell. X isn't very effective for that. Might be better over
> > SSH with compression.
> 
> my test *was* over ssh with compression ;-)

Then try without compression, and optionally without ssh encryption.

Accessing a SunPC card in a remote Sun over ssh is unusable as well, while it
works reasonably with plain X11 over port 6000.
